Categories Integrated Circuits
Manufacturer Maxim Integrated
Packaging Tube
Status Obsolete
Amplifier Type Instrumentation
Output Type Rail-to-Rail
Slew Rate 0.06V/μs
-3db Bandwidth 220kHz
Current - Input Bias 6nA
Voltage - Input Offset 100μV
Supply Current 93μA
Current - Output / Channel 4.5mA
Supply Voltage , Single/Dual (±) 2.7V ~ 7.5V, ±1.35V ~ 3.75V
Temperature Range - Operating -40°C ~ 85°C
Mounting Style SMD
Manufacturer Package 8-SOIC
Supplier Device Package 8-SOIC
Family Part Number MAX4195
Manufacturer Pack Quantity 1
MSL Level 1 (Unlimited)
